BC3 Pioneers - A History of Championships

Since its inception in 1966, BC3 has been committed to both quality academic and successful athletic programs. The Pioneers participate in the Western Pennsylvania Collegiate Conference (WPCC), Pennsylvania Collegiate Athletic Association (PCAA) and the National Junior College Athletic Association (NJCAA). This success is evident in the thirty-one WPCC conference championships, ten PCAA state championships, four Region XX championships and ten All-Americans that the Pioneers have produced.
